Emergency Messaging System

91دم½¶تسئµ Emergency Messaging System (91دم½¶تسئµ Alert) is a resource for faculty, staff and students to receive text message alerts from 91دم½¶تسئµ about potential, developing, or existing emergencies.

The 91دم½¶تسئµ Alert system allows the school to quickly communicate health and safety-related information through a combination of various communication methods.

In the event that information needs to be communicated to students and staff immediately, 91دم½¶تسئµ will use several information delivery methods to make sure the pertinent information reaches you.

91دم½¶تسئµ Alert will be used solely for the purpose of alerting the 91دم½¶تسئµ community in an emergency. These emergency notices will be delivered via phone calls, text messages to mobile devices, and e-mail.

All students, faculty and staff are automatically registered to receive alerts.

Please note that emergency notifications will be limited to those related to health and safety concerns for 91دم½¶تسئµ students, faculty and staff; or disruption of school functions due to severe weather, crime, or other concerns. These notices are also limited to situations or events within the boundaries of the 91دم½¶تسئµ main campus in Lewisburg.

If an emergency occurs, the emergency management operations team, in consultation with the senior administration will determine the need for a 91دم½¶تسئµ Alert message.

What is Omnilert?

91دم½¶تسئµ has contracted with Omnilert, LLC emergency notification system. Omnilert is a fully web-based emergency notification network that allows emergency management teams to generate time–sensitive communications to students, faculty, staff, campus security, first responders, and others. These notifications will be broadcast by text messaging, voice mail, and e-mail.

Omnilert, LLC is the provider of the 91دم½¶تسئµ mass notification system.

Do I need an app or software installed on my phone?

Downloading the Omnilert app is optional as it is not required to receive emergency notifications. During certain emergency situations the emergency management operations team may select to engage in two-way communications allowing you to respond to questions through the mobile app. The same communication exchange can be achieved by clicking a web link which will be included in an emergency alert e-mail during certain emergency situations. The Omnilert app can be downloaded from the App Store or Google Play. Once the app is installed on your mobile device you will need your unique personal access code which was sent to you by email at the time your account was registered. If you do not have the email containing your code please contact the 91دم½¶تسئµ Helpdesk.

What might an alert message say?

In an actual emergency, you will receive information regarding the situation with instructions on what to do. Here are a few sample messages you may receive:

  • ACT OF VIOLENCE REPORTED on the 91دم½¶تسئµ campus (campus location will be added). Campus closed; Go/remain indoors, lock all doors/windows, stay away from windows, do not open locked doors for anyone. Await further message.
  • A BOMB THREAT has been reported at (building name), on the 91دم½¶تسئµ campus. Check your work area for suspicious items-report any found to Campus Security at 304 647-8911 and EVACUATE to the assembly area. Await additional info.
  • There is a POLICE EMERGENCY on the 91دم½¶تسئµ campus (campus location); building or campus is closed. Go or remain indoors and await further information.

Do I confirm receipt of the message? What happens if I don't?

Though receipt confirmation is not required, it is preferable for you to do so if at all possible if you are asked to do so. This is especially important if two-way communication has been enabled and the e-mail message contains a web link or you are using the mobile app and have received a question. When you confirm that you have received the message or respond to a question, you will free up system resources to contact other members of the WVOSM community who may not have gotten the message yet. In an emergency this will save valuable time – and, possibly, lives.

Does 91دم½¶تسئµ test the alert system?

Yes. 91دم½¶تسئµ will test the 91دم½¶تسئµ Alert System at least once per semester. The campus community will be notified in advance when a test of the system is scheduled to take place.

How can I opt out of receiving messages?

Upon receipt of an emergency alert email click the “Unsubscribeâ€‌ link located at the bottom of the message. You will need to do this for each email address on file, so if you provided 91دم½¶تسئµ with an alternate email address you will also need to unsubscribe from that address as well.

Upon receipt of an emergency alert text message reply to the message with; Unsubscribe, Stop or Quit. You will need to do this for each cell phone number you have provided to 91دم½¶تسئµ.

If you have downloaded the mobile app and decide you no longer want to receive emergency alerts simply remove the app from your device.

How long is my contact information retained? What happens to my information when I leave 91دم½¶تسئµ?

Faculty and staff information will be deleted upon separation from 91دم½¶تسئµ, unless an affiliate status is established by the President. Student information is deleted thirty days following that last day of enrollment.
